Align draw merge default comment
This commit is contained in:
@@ -413,6 +413,10 @@ agent or engineer to remove them without reconstructing context from chat.
|
|||||||
`make_canvas_draw_merge_branch_dispatch(...)` forward declaration in
|
`make_canvas_draw_merge_branch_dispatch(...)` forward declaration in
|
||||||
`src/canvas.cpp` now matches the 7-argument implementation, shrinking the
|
`src/canvas.cpp` now matches the 7-argument implementation, shrinking the
|
||||||
remaining draw-merge helper API mismatch while `STR-016` stays blocked.
|
remaining draw-merge helper API mismatch while `STR-016` stays blocked.
|
||||||
|
- 2026-06-15: `DEBT-0036` was narrowed again. The remaining
|
||||||
|
`Canvas::draw_merge()` inline-default comment in `src/canvas.cpp` now
|
||||||
|
matches the header's `SIXPLETTE(true)` default, so the draw-merge mismatch
|
||||||
|
is comment-only and aligned while `STR-016` stays blocked.
|
||||||
- 2026-06-14: `DEBT-0036` was narrowed again. `Canvas::draw_merge_branch_orchestration()`
|
- 2026-06-14: `DEBT-0036` was narrowed again. `Canvas::draw_merge_branch_orchestration()`
|
||||||
now routes the temporary erase, temporary paint, texture, and blend dispatch
|
now routes the temporary erase, temporary paint, texture, and blend dispatch
|
||||||
bodies through retained helpers inside `execute_canvas_draw_merge_branch_body(...)`;
|
bodies through retained helpers inside `execute_canvas_draw_merge_branch_body(...)`;
|
||||||
|
|||||||
@@ -80,6 +80,9 @@ families debt-tracked.
|
|||||||
The stale `make_canvas_draw_merge_branch_dispatch(...)` forward declaration in
|
The stale `make_canvas_draw_merge_branch_dispatch(...)` forward declaration in
|
||||||
`src/canvas.cpp` now matches the existing 7-argument implementation, shrinking
|
`src/canvas.cpp` now matches the existing 7-argument implementation, shrinking
|
||||||
the remaining draw-merge helper API mismatch while `STR-016` stays blocked.
|
the remaining draw-merge helper API mismatch while `STR-016` stays blocked.
|
||||||
|
The remaining `Canvas::draw_merge()` inline-default comment in `src/canvas.cpp`
|
||||||
|
now matches the header's `SIXPLETTE(true)` default, so the draw-merge mismatch
|
||||||
|
is comment-only and aligned while `STR-016` stays blocked.
|
||||||
The cloud browser dialog now also opens through that seam from
|
The cloud browser dialog now also opens through that seam from
|
||||||
`src/legacy_cloud_services.cpp`, so the remaining cloud modernization debt is
|
`src/legacy_cloud_services.cpp`, so the remaining cloud modernization debt is
|
||||||
now concentrated in retained background worker threads, transfer helpers,
|
now concentrated in retained background worker threads, transfer helpers,
|
||||||
|
|||||||
@@ -2226,7 +2226,7 @@ void Canvas::stroke_commit_timelapse()
|
|||||||
}
|
}
|
||||||
}
|
}
|
||||||
|
|
||||||
void Canvas::draw_merge(bool draw_checkerboard, std::array<bool, 6> faces /*= SIXPLETTE(false)*/)
|
void Canvas::draw_merge(bool draw_checkerboard, std::array<bool, 6> faces /*= SIXPLETTE(true)*/)
|
||||||
{
|
{
|
||||||
assert(App::I->is_render_thread());
|
assert(App::I->is_render_thread());
|
||||||
|
|
||||||
|
|||||||
Reference in New Issue
Block a user